Discovering OSCIII Volleyball Opportunities
So, you're on the hunt for OSCIII volleyball action nearby? Great choice! Volleyball is a fantastic way to stay active, meet new people, and have a blast. But where do you even begin to find these opportunities? Let's break it down. Start with a simple Google search. Type in "OSCIII volleyball near me" or "recreational volleyball leagues in [your city]." Don't forget to check out local community centers and YMCA's, as they often host recreational leagues for various sports, including volleyball. These leagues are usually beginner-friendly and focus on fun and fitness rather than intense competition. Another great resource is social media. Facebook groups dedicated to local sports or volleyball enthusiasts can be goldmines for finding pickup games and informal gatherings. You can also explore platforms like Meetup.com, which often features sports-related groups organizing regular volleyball sessions. When evaluating your options, consider factors like the league's skill level, the cost to participate, and the convenience of the location and game times. Look for leagues that offer different divisions to accommodate various skill levels, from beginner to advanced. This ensures you'll be playing with people of similar abilities, making the experience more enjoyable and challenging. Also, check the league's rules and regulations to understand the game format and any specific guidelines. Don't be afraid to try out a few different options before committing to a league or club. Many leagues offer trial periods or drop-in sessions, allowing you to get a feel for the environment and see if it's the right fit for you. Remember, the goal is to have fun and stay active, so choose a league that aligns with your interests and schedule.
The Benefits of Joining a Recreational Volleyball Community
Joining an OSCIII volleyball recreational community offers a plethora of benefits that extend far beyond the court. First and foremost, it's an excellent way to stay physically active. Volleyball involves running, jumping, and quick reflexes, providing a full-body workout that improves cardiovascular health, strength, and agility. Regular participation in volleyball can also help you maintain a healthy weight and reduce your risk of chronic diseases. Beyond the physical benefits, recreational volleyball offers significant social advantages. It's a fantastic way to meet new people who share your passion for the sport. These connections can lead to lasting friendships and expand your social circle. Being part of a team also fosters a sense of camaraderie and belonging. You'll learn to work together, communicate effectively, and support your teammates, which are valuable skills that can translate to other areas of your life. Moreover, volleyball is a great stress reliever. The focus and energy required to play the game can help you clear your mind and forget about the day's worries. The endorphins released during physical activity can also boost your mood and reduce feelings of anxiety and depression. Participating in recreational volleyball can also enhance your cognitive skills. The fast-paced nature of the game requires quick thinking, decision-making, and strategic planning. You'll learn to anticipate your opponents' moves, adapt to changing situations, and make split-second decisions, all of which can sharpen your mental acuity. Finally, recreational volleyball is simply a lot of fun! It's a chance to let loose, be competitive, and enjoy the thrill of the game. Whether you're spiking a ball over the net or diving to make a save, volleyball provides moments of excitement and satisfaction that can brighten your day. So, if you're looking for a fun, social, and physically rewarding activity, joining a recreational volleyball community is an excellent choice.
What to Look for in an OSCIII Volleyball League or Club
When selecting an OSCIII volleyball league or club, several factors should be considered to ensure a positive and fulfilling experience. First and foremost, assess the skill level of the league or club. Look for options that offer different divisions to accommodate various skill levels, from beginner to advanced. This ensures you'll be playing with individuals who have similar abilities, promoting fair competition and enjoyment. A beginner playing in an advanced league might feel overwhelmed and discouraged, while an advanced player in a beginner league might find the competition too easy and unstimulating. Secondly, consider the league's or club's organization and structure. A well-organized league will have clear rules, schedules, and communication channels. They should also have qualified referees and coaches who can provide guidance and support. A structured environment ensures fair play and minimizes confusion or disputes. Look for leagues that have a designated contact person who can answer your questions and address any concerns. Thirdly, evaluate the facilities and equipment provided by the league or club. The volleyball court should be well-maintained and have appropriate dimensions. The net should be in good condition and properly tensioned. The balls should be of good quality and suitable for indoor or outdoor play. Access to amenities like changing rooms, showers, and water fountains can also enhance your overall experience. Fourthly, consider the cost of participating in the league or club. Fees can vary depending on the league's or club's size, location, and offerings. Be sure to inquire about all associated costs, including registration fees, membership dues, and equipment expenses. Compare the costs of different leagues or clubs to find an option that fits your budget. Fifthly, check the league's or club's reputation and reviews. Talk to other players or read online reviews to get a sense of the league's or club's atmosphere and culture. Look for leagues or clubs that are known for their sportsmanship, fairness, and positive environment. A supportive and inclusive community can greatly enhance your volleyball experience. Finally, consider the location and schedule of the league or club. Choose a league or club that is conveniently located and offers game times that fit your schedule. This will make it easier for you to attend regularly and maintain your commitment to the sport. By considering these factors, you can find an OSCIII volleyball league or club that meets your needs and provides a rewarding and enjoyable experience.
Tips for Making the Most of Your OSCIII Volleyball Journey
To truly maximize your OSCIII volleyball journey, consider these valuable tips that can enhance your skills, enjoyment, and overall experience. First and foremost, focus on developing your fundamental skills. Mastering the basics of serving, passing, setting, and spiking is crucial for improving your game. Practice these skills regularly, even outside of organized games or practices. Use drills and exercises to target specific areas for improvement. Seek guidance from experienced players or coaches who can provide feedback and correct your technique. Secondly, prioritize teamwork and communication. Volleyball is a team sport, and success depends on effective collaboration and communication. Learn to anticipate your teammates' moves, communicate clearly on the court, and support each other. Develop a strong sense of camaraderie and trust within your team. Thirdly, stay physically fit and conditioned. Volleyball requires agility, speed, and endurance. Engage in regular exercise to improve your overall fitness level. Focus on exercises that strengthen your core, legs, and upper body. Incorporate cardio workouts to enhance your stamina. Proper stretching and warm-up routines are also essential for preventing injuries. Fourthly, be a good sport and maintain a positive attitude. Volleyball should be enjoyable for everyone involved. Display good sportsmanship by respecting your opponents, referees, and teammates. Avoid complaining or arguing, and focus on playing your best. A positive attitude can boost your performance and create a more enjoyable environment for everyone. Fifthly, set realistic goals and track your progress. Identify specific areas you want to improve and set achievable goals. Monitor your progress over time and celebrate your successes. Don't get discouraged by setbacks, but rather use them as learning opportunities. Sixthly, stay hydrated and nourish your body properly. Drink plenty of water before, during, and after volleyball activities. Consume a balanced diet that provides adequate energy and nutrients. Avoid sugary drinks and processed foods that can hinder your performance. Seventhly, seek out opportunities to learn from others. Watch professional volleyball games or instructional videos to gain insights into advanced techniques and strategies. Attend volleyball clinics or workshops to receive expert guidance. Learn from experienced players and coaches who can share their knowledge and expertise. Finally, most importantly, have fun and enjoy the experience! Volleyball is a great way to stay active, socialize, and challenge yourself. Embrace the joy of the game and let it bring you happiness and fulfillment. By following these tips, you can make the most of your OSCIII volleyball journey and create lasting memories.
